Stopping anti-rejection drugs after pediatric liver transplant

This trial tests whether children who had a liver transplant before age 6 can safely stop taking their anti-rejection medicine. It's for children who are doing well — with normal liver function and no signs of rejection or scarring — at least 4 years after transplant.

Who can take part

  • Your child had a liver transplant before age 6.
  • It has been at least 4 years since the transplant.
  • Your child's liver function is currently normal.
  • Your child takes only one anti-rejection medicine (either tacrolimus or cyclosporine A).
  • A liver biopsy done within the last 2 years showed no signs of rejection or significant scarring.
  • Your child has not had a hepatitis infection in the last year.
